> +#!/bin/sh
> +#
> +# init script for the Ethernet Bridge filter tables
> +#
> +# Written by Dag Wieers <[email protected]>
> +# Modified by Rok Papez <[email protected]>
> +#         Bart De Schuymer <[email protected]>
> +# Adapted to Debian by Jan Christoph Nordholz <[email protected]>
> +# Adapted to OpenEmbedded by Roman I Khimov <[email protected]>
> +#
> +# chkconfig: - 15 85
> +# description: Ethernet Bridge filtering tables
> +#
> +### BEGIN INIT INFO
> +# Provides:          ebtables
> +# Required-Start:    
> +# Required-Stop:     
> +# Should-Start:              $local_fs
> +# Should-Stop:               $local_fs
> +# Default-Start:     S
> +# Default-Stop:              0 6
> +# Short-Description: ebtables ruleset management
> +# Description:               Saves and restores the state of the ebtables 
> rulesets.
> +### END INIT INFO
> +
> +[ -x /sbin/ebtables ] || exit 1
> +
> +E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M=/etc/ebtables/dump
> +
> +RETVAL=0
> +prog="ebtables"
> +desc="Ethernet bridge filtering"
> +umask 0077
> +
> +#default configuration
> +EBTABLES_MODULES_UNLOAD="yes"
> +EBTABLES_LOAD_ON_START="no"
> +EBTABLES_SAVE_ON_STOP="no"
> +EBTABLES_SAVE_ON_RESTART="no"
> +EBTABLES_SAVE_COUNTER="no"
> +EBTABLES_BACKUP_SUFFIX="~"
> +
> +config=/etc/default/$prog
> +[ -f "$config" ] && . "$config"
> +
> +function get_supported_tables() {
> +     E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ES=
> +     /sbin/ebtables -t filter -L 2>&1 1>/dev/null | grep -q permission
> +     if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
> +             echo "Error: insufficient privileges to access the ebtables 
> rulesets."
> +             exit 1
> +     fi
> +     for table in filter nat broute; do
> +             /sbin/ebtables -t $table -L &> /dev/null
> +             if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
> +                     E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ES="${E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ES} 
> $table"
> +             fi
> +     done
> +}
> +
> +function load() {
> +     RETVAL=0
> +     get_supported_tables
> +     echo -n "Restoring ebtables rulesets: "
> +     for table in $E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ES; do
> +             echo -n "$table "
> +             if [ -s 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table ]; then
> +                     /sbin/ebtables -t $table --atomic-file 
> 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table --atomic-commit
> +                     RET=$?
> +                     if [ $RET -ne 0 ]; then
> +                             echo -n "(failed) "
> +                             RETVAL=$RET
> +                     fi
> +             else
> +                     echo -n "(no saved state) "
> +             fi
> +     done
> +     if [ -z "$E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ES" ]; then
> +             echo -n "no kernel support. "
> +     else
> +             echo -n "done. "
> +     fi
> +     if [ $RETVAL -eq 0 ]; then
> +             echo "ok"
> +     else
> +             echo "fail"
> +     fi
> +}
> +
> +function clear() {
> +     RETVAL=0
> +     get_supported_tables
> +     echo -n "Clearing ebtables rulesets: "
> +     for table in $E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ES; do
> +             echo -n "$table "
> +             /sbin/ebtables -t $table --init-table
> +     done
> +
> +     if [ "$EBTABLES_MODULES_UNLOAD" = "yes" ]; then
> +             for mod in $(grep -E '^(ebt|ebtable)_' /proc/modules | cut -d' 
> ' -f1) ebtables; do
> +                     rmmod $mod 2> /dev/null
> +             done
> +     fi
> +     if [ -z "$E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ES" ]; then
> +             echo -n "no kernel support. "
> +     else
> +             echo -n "done. "
> +     fi
> +     if [ $RETVAL -eq 0 ]; then
> +             echo "ok"
> +     else
> +             echo "fail"
> +     fi
> +}
> +
> +function save() {
> +     RETVAL=0
> +     get_supported_tables
> +     echo -n "Saving ebtables rulesets: "
> +     for table in $E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ES; do
> +             echo -n "$table "
> +             [ -n "$EBTABLES_BACKUP_SUFFIX" ] && [ -s 
> 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table ] && \
> +               mv 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table 
> 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table$EBTABLES_BACKUP_SUFFIX
> +             /sbin/ebtables -t $table --atomic-file 
> 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table --atomic-save
> +             RET=$?
> +             if [ $RET -ne 0 ]; then
> +                     echo -n "(failed) "
> +                     RETVAL=$RET
> +             else
> +                     if [ "$EBTABLES_SAVE_COUNTER" = "no" ]; then
> +                             /sbin/ebtables -t $table --atomic-file 
> ${EBTABLES_DUMPFILE_STEM}.$table -Z
> +                     fi
> +             fi
> +     done
> +     if [ -z "$E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ES" ]; then
> +             echo -n "no kernel support. "
> +     else
> +             echo -n "done. "
> +     fi
> +     if [ $RETVAL -eq 0 ]; then
> +             echo "ok"
> +     else
> +             echo "fail"
> +     fi
> +}
> +
> +case "$1" in
> +  start)
> +     [ "$EBTABLES_LOAD_ON_START" = "yes" ] && load
> +     ;;
> +  stop)
> +     [ "$EBTABLES_SAVE_ON_STOP" = "yes" ] && save
> +     clear
> +     ;;
> +  restart|reload|force-reload)
> +     [ "$EBTABLES_SAVE_ON_RESTART" = "yes" ] && save
> +     clear
> +     [ "$EBTABLES_LOAD_ON_START" = "yes" ] && load
> +     ;;
> +  load)
> +     load
> +     ;;
> +  save)
> +     save
> +     ;;
> +  status)
> +     get_supported_tables
> +     if [ -z "$E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ES" ]; then
> +             echo "No kernel support for ebtables."
> +             RETVAL=1
> +     else
> +             echo -n "Ebtables support available, number of installed rules: 
> "
> +             for table in $EBTABLES_SUPPORTED_TABLES; do
> +                     COUNT=$(( $(/sbin/ebtables -t $table -L | sed -e 
> "/^Bridge chain/! d" -e "s/^.*entries: //" -e "s/,.*$/ +/") 0 ))
> +                     echo -n "$table($COUNT) "
> +             done
> +             echo ok
> +             RETVAL=0
> +     fi
> +     ;;
> +  *)
> +     echo "Usage: $0 
> {start|stop|restart|reload|force-reload|load|save|status}" >&2
> +     RETVAL=1
> +esac
> +
> +exit $RETVAL
